皮特·蒙德里安对于绘画从具象走向抽象的发展产生了决定性影响。值此艺术家诞辰150周年之际,《蒙德里安·演进》特展全面呈现其多元创作与艺术成长轨迹。蒙德里安早期创作承袭了十九世纪荷兰风景画传统,后又深受象征主义与立体主义影响。直至1920年代初,艺术家才最终确立了纯粹非具象的绘画语汇,专注于以黑色直线分割画面,并于形成的矩形中填入白色与蓝、红、黄三原色。本次展览分章节追溯其风格演变,透过风车、沙丘、海洋、水中倒映的农舍以及各种抽象形态的植物等主题,清晰勾勒出他的艺术发展路径。
皮特·蒙德里安(1872–1944)是抽象艺术先驱之一。这位出身于严格加尔文派家庭的艺术家,虽以其标志性的黑色线条与三原色矩形组合闻名于世,但其早期作品实则深受十九世纪荷兰风景画传统的影响。
Piet Mondrian had a decisive influence on the development of painting from figuration to abstraction. On the occasion of his 150th birthday, Mondrian Evolution is dedicated to his multifaceted work and artistic development. Initially working in the tradition of late-nineteenth century Dutch landscape painting, Symbolism and Cubism subsequently took on great significance for him. It was not until the early 1920s that the artist focused on a wholly non-representational pictorial vocabulary, concentrated on the rectangular arrangement of black lines with surfaces in white and the primary colors blue, red, and yellow. In separate chapters, this path is traced through motifs such as windmills, dunes, the sea, farms reflected in the water, and plants in various forms of abstraction.
PIET MONDRIAN (1872–1944) was one of the pioneers of abstract art. Hailing from a strict Calvinist family, the artist became famous for his compositions of black lines and rectangular fields in primary colors, but his early work was influenced by 19th century Dutch landscape painting.
